8 reasons Medical Affairs teams require an AI-augment solution

Medical Affairs performs a vital function in how pharma companies develop new drugs and therapies. These teams coordinate how a new drug moves from product development to commercialization.

Additionally, Medical Affairs will identify market gaps to exploit, liaise with KOLs, oversee clinical trials, conduct research, and work as a source of medical expertise to support marketing and commercial teams.

The primary objective of Medical Affairs is the creation of a new product’s value proposition. These teams work closely with various stakeholders, including key opinion leaders, regulatory bodies, and internal research and development departments, to ensure that the proposed value proposition aligns with the latest medical insights and industry standards. In this process, they meticulously analyze clinical data, conduct comprehensive market research, and collaborate with cross-functional teams to ensure that the value proposition is robust and addresses unmet medical needs effectively.

Therefore, Medical Affairs are crucial to the success of an HCP companionship. We are all aware that it’s challenging, complex, and intensive work, and this blog discusses how Artificial Intelligence (AI) may boost the efficiency of the Medical Affairs team and create further added value.

Reducing The Volumes

Medical Affairs gather and collate an extensive volume of medical information and data. Given today’s accelerated pace of medical innovation, many databases are needed to stay on top of the latest advances. AI assists medical affairs teams in exploiting these growing resources driving out deeper insights, strengthening the medical community engagement, and finding positive outcomes for the whole organization.

Speed Up Literature Reviews

Literature, by nature, is unstructured data. It’s almost impossible to link data points in an array of text documents, for example, data presented in a spreadsheet. However, AI can quickly and efficiently connect undifferentiated written sources and extract information that helps Medical Affairs understand the entire content. AI enables KOL data, medical information, and open medical sources to be rapidly utilized to supplement search results or merged into a single source to provide a complete picture.

Leverage existing content repositories

Large biopharma companies store scientific information, KOL logs, and data from clinical trials across multiple teams over several geographies. This situation is a barrier to insight generation as the data may exist in various formats or languages, and sharing methods may be inefficient. These fragmented systems cause the Medical Affairs team to miss vital trends that promote the rapid development of therapies that will help patients. 

AI cuts through this undifferentiated morass effortlessly circumventing language issues and technical challenges to give Medical Affairs teams a global view to inform their work.

Real-Time Data Analysis

AI can assist medical affairs teams in gathering and analyzing data uncovering patterns and trends that analysts consume lot of their valuable time. These hitherto unknown links can assist in many areas including clinical trial design, patient population identification and inform product development and commercialization.

Improve HCP Experience

Medical Affairs teams use CRMs like Veeva or Salesforce to capture the conversations they have with HCPs while conducting field research. This knowledge is frequently underutilized. Medical Affairs teams may gather these high-value client encounters in one place by using AI tools to extract value from them. As a result, Medical Affairs can regularly monitor key topics, views, data gaps, and other relevant areas. Additionally, the medical strategies of pharmaceutical firms continue to evolve by incorporating HCP feedback.

Data-Driven Decision Making

Medical affairs curate a large volume of medical information and data. But because most datasets are curated manually, this ends with a complicated data structure. The knock-on effect is ongoing difficulties engaging KOLs in clinical trials and identifying relevant information, leaders, or individuals that offer beneficial support. AI makes it simpler and faster to uncover hidden associations and visualize the data in these resources by generating interactive graphs. As a result, Medical Affairs teams have additional resources to make better data-driven decisions.

Power Through Complex Processes

AI can assist medical affairs teams with complicated procedures such as regulatory compliance.  AI systems that have been properly instructed will be able to spot potential adverse events, keep track of negative outcomes, and ensure regulatory compliance. Pharmaceutical products must be entirely compliant, safe, and effective while promoting patient health. Currently, the process is manual and relies on an Excel spreadsheet or similar uncertain tool, making mistakes more likely (and with more serious consequences). AI streamlines this procedure by getting rid of plain text files and structuring the data in a usable, searchable manner.
